E-commerce Platforms

Shopify

Shopify is one of the most popular e-commerce platforms, and for good reason. It offers a user-friendly interface and a wide range of customizable themes, making it easy to set up and design your online store. With its built-in features for inventory management, secure payment processing, and marketing tools, Shopify is an ideal choice for entrepreneurs looking to start their online business without any coding knowledge.

WooCommerce

If you already have a WordPress website, WooCommerce is an excellent option for adding e-commerce functionality. With its seamless integration with WordPress, you can create a professional online store and take advantage of numerous plugins and extensions to enhance its features. WooCommerce is highly customizable and offers a flexible platform suitable for businesses of all sizes.

Magento

For larger enterprises with complex e-commerce needs, Magento is a powerful platform that provides unlimited scalability and advanced functionalities. It offers robust features such as multi-store capabilities, powerful SEO tools, and extensive customization options. However, Magento requires technical expertise and may not be suitable for small businesses or those new to e-commerce.

BigCommerce

BigCommerce is a comprehensive e-commerce platform that caters to businesses of all sizes. It offers a wide range of built-in features, including secure payment options, advanced SEO tools, and seamless integrations with popular marketplaces. With its user-friendly interface and responsive design templates, BigCommerce allows you to create a professional online store with ease.

Marketplace Platforms

Amazon

As the largest online marketplace, Amazon provides an extensive customer base and a powerful fulfillment network through Amazon FBA (Fulfillment by Amazon). Selling on Amazon allows you to reach millions of potential buyers, and with the right strategies, you can take advantage of Amazon’s search algorithm and boost your sales.

eBay

eBay is a popular auction-style marketplace where you can sell both new and used products. With its global reach and diverse customer base, eBay is an excellent platform for sellers looking to reach a wide audience. It offers various listing options and tools to optimize your listings, making it easy to start selling and grow your business.

Etsy

Etsy is a niche marketplace known for its focus on handmade, vintage, and unique items. If you create artisan products or offer vintage collectibles, Etsy provides a dedicated community of buyers looking for one-of-a-kind items. With its easy-to-use interface and seller-friendly policies, Etsy is a great platform to showcase your craftsmanship and connect with like-minded buyers.

Walmart

Walmart Marketplace is an emerging platform that offers significant opportunities for sellers to expand their reach. With over 120 million monthly visitors, Walmart provides access to a massive customer base and offers various integration options for seamless inventory management. Selling on Walmart Marketplace can be highly lucrative, especially for businesses in specific product categories.

Digital Product Platforms

Gumroad

Gumroad is a popular platform for selling digital products such as e-books, online courses, music, and software. With its simple setup process and user-friendly interface, Gumroad allows creators to monetize their digital content with ease. By utilizing Gumroad’s marketing tools and integrations, you can reach a broader audience and increase your digital product sales.

Teachable

Teachable is an all-in-one platform for creating and selling online courses. With its robust features for course creation, marketing, and analytics, Teachable provides a comprehensive solution for educators and entrepreneurs. Whether you’re a subject matter expert or an experienced instructor, Teachable allows you to design and sell high-quality courses and engage with your students.

Podia

Podia is a versatile platform that enables creators to sell digital products, online courses, and membership subscriptions. With its intuitive interface and a range of customizable templates, Podia makes it easy to create a professional storefront and showcase your digital content. Podia also offers built-in features for email marketing and affiliate programs, helping you grow your audience and increase your revenue.

Selz

Selz is an e-commerce platform that specializes in selling digital products, physical goods, and services. With its user-friendly interface and customizable design templates, Selz provides a seamless way to sell and deliver digital products to your customers. Selz also offers features for efficient order tracking, secure payment processing, and built-in SEO optimization, making it an excellent choice for businesses looking to monetize their digital assets.

Subscription Box Platforms

Cratejoy

Cratejoy is a leading platform for selling and managing subscription box businesses. With its comprehensive features for recurring billing, product customization, and shipping management, Cratejoy provides a complete solution for entrepreneurs looking to enter the subscription box market. By utilizing Cratejoy’s marketplace and affiliate network, you can reach a broad audience and connect with subscription box enthusiasts.

Subbly

Subbly is a subscription e-commerce platform that simplifies the process of creating and managing subscription-based businesses. With its user-friendly interface and built-in marketing tools, Subbly allows you to offer customizable subscription plans and automate recurring billing. Subbly also provides features for inventory management and customer relationship management (CRM), making it easy to scale your subscription business.

Recharge

Recharge is a popular platform that specializes in managing and growing subscription businesses on Shopify. With its seamless integration, Recharge offers advanced features for subscription customization, flexible billing, and churn reduction. By utilizing Recharge’s analytics and customer management tools, you can optimize your subscription strategy and increase customer retention.

Bold Subscriptions

Bold Subscriptions is a robust platform that provides a wide range of features for creating and managing subscription-based businesses on various e-commerce platforms, including Shopify, WooCommerce, and BigCommerce. With its flexible subscription models, customizable designs, and extensive third-party integrations, Bold Subscriptions offers a comprehensive solution for businesses of all sizes.

Print-on-Demand Platforms

Printful

Printful is a popular print-on-demand platform that allows you to create custom-designed products, including apparel, accessories, home décor, and more. With its seamless integration with various e-commerce platforms, Printful automates the printing, packaging, and shipping process, making it easy to start your own brand without inventory costs. Printful also offers a wide range of products and printing techniques to suit your specific needs.

Printify

Similar to Printful, Printify is a print-on-demand platform that offers a wide range of customizable products for your e-commerce store. Printify partners with various printing facilities worldwide, enabling you to choose the most suitable provider based on factors such as pricing, quality, and shipping options. By utilizing Printify’s mockup generator and fulfillment automation, you can create and sell custom products with ease.

Redbubble

Redbubble is a print-on-demand marketplace that allows artists and designers to showcase their artwork on various products. With its user-friendly interface and global customer base, Redbubble enables artists to sell their designs on products such as clothing, wall art, phone cases, and more. By uploading your artwork to Redbubble, you can reach a broad audience and generate passive income through royalties.

Society6

Society6 is another print-on-demand marketplace that focuses on art and design products. With its vibrant community of artists, Society6 offers a platform for creators to sell their artwork on a wide range of products, including home decor, apparel, and accessories. Society6 handles the production, printing, and shipping, leaving artists free to focus on their creativity and marketing.
